June 29 (Bloomberg) — Bloomberg’s Courtney Donohoe reports on the performance of the U.S. equity market today.
U.S. stocks plummeted, sending the Standard & Poor’s 500 Index to its lowest level since Oct. 30, on concern over weakening growth in China and a slump in American consumer confidence. Bloomberg’s Pimm Fox also speaks. (Source: Bloomberg)

Computer Network Tips : How to Improve the Range of Your Wireless Network

Posted on June 26th, 2010 by admin in networking computers | 6 Comments »

Improve the range of a wireless network by using a router with tow antennas and centrally locating the router in a dwelling. Increase wireless network range with tips from a computer specialist in this free video on computer networking.

General Computer Tips : How to Find Out if You Have a Network Card in Your PC & What Type it Is

Posted on June 21st, 2010 by admin in networking computers | 5 Comments »

Find out if a computer has a network card by clicking on the device manager feature in Windows Vista or the my computer feature in Windows XP to locate information related to the network adapters. Computer Networking & Hardware : How to Install a Fan in a Computer

Posted on June 8th, 2010 by admin in networking computers | No Comments »

Installing a fan in a computer is usually a simple project, as many fans have locked mechanisms that hold them into place and use a four-connector hole that slides into the fan power on the motherboard. Common Networking Topologies

Posted on June 4th, 2010 by admin in networking computers | 1 Comment »

What is a network topology? It’s simply the geography or layout of a network. Which type is best for a particular environment depends on a number of factors, including the number of computers (nodes) on the network and the geographical area. IBM Agrees to Buy Sterling Commerce for $1.4 Billion: Video

Posted on May 27th, 2010 by admin in networking computers | No Comments »

May 24 (Bloomberg) — International Business Machines Corp. and AT&T Inc. said they agreed for IBM to acquire Sterling Commerce from AT&T for about $1.4 billion in cash. Bloomberg’s Betty Liu reports. (Source: Bloomberg)
